In this 1843 sermon based on John 1:11-13, J. C. Philpot examines why some reject Christ and others receive Him. He further describes those who become sons of God and those who only profess to be sons of God. Explaining that the primary cause underlying all of this is found in the sovereign will of God, Philpot points out that there are also a number of secondary causes. For example, those who reject Christ do so because of blindness of heart, self-righteousness, worldliness of mind, or unbelief. In addition, he explores the motives of those who falsely profess a heavenly birth under three headings taken from John 1:13—born of blood, born of the will of the flesh, and born of the will of man. Philpot concludes with a description of those who are truly born of God.
